dc.description.abstractUnderstanding the variables that affect airline operations is crucial in a competitive sector as air transport. The present work will try to shed some light into the determinants of the demand for domestic air travel for Auckland Region using service-related and geoeconomic factors. An Error Correction Model will be developed in order to estimate the income and price elasticities of this particular segment of the market, as well as the substitution effect with other means of transport and the quality of the service provided. It is found that lowering the price is not truly effective to stimulate demand in the short nor in the long run as the main driver of the growth of domestic demand is the income effect.
